Ousmane Sonko is from the Casamance region of Senegal. His educational journey reflects how many young people from Casamance have successfully integrated into the national education system. A member of the Jola ethnic group, the primary ethnic group in Casamance, he benefited from a strong educational foundation thanks to his parents, both teachers who emphasized the importance of education. Sonko attended Gaston Berger University, a public institution in Saint-Louis near Dakar. After completing his studies, he passed the entrance exam for the École Nationale d’Administration (ENA), a public institution in Senegal that trains government officials and administrators.
